Wong, Ninvalle and Thomas on Pan-Am Games prep squad

0

Miguel Wong, Kaysan Ninvalle and Thuraia Thomas are among some of talented players the Guyana Table Tennis Association (GTTA) is looking to enlist to begin training for the Junior Pan American Games to be held in Cali, Colombia, between September 9-19, 2021.

After a promising, but unsuccessful outing for Guyanese players at the Olympic Qualifiers earlier this month in Argentina, the GTTA is now focused on preparing a team to qualify for the Junior Pan-Am Games.

However, GTTA President, Godfrey Munroe, explained that given the prevailing COVID-19 situation, there is a strong possibility that Guyanese players may be awarded spots based on world rankings.

The qualifiers are slated to be held in June in Costa Rica.

Munroe explained that Jonathan VanLange, Kaysan Ninvalle, Miguel Wong, Collin Wong, Jamal Nicholas, Terrence Rauch, Thuraia Thomas, Yudestir Persaud, Neveah Clarkson, Akira Watson, Crystal Melville, Jasmine Billingy and Samara Sukhai are some of the names on the proposed training squad.

“When we write them and they express an interest in participating in the preparation and qualification trials and the selection process we may have, then we can finalise those positions once we agree.”

The Games is a forthcoming international multi-sports event for athletes aged 18 to 21 in the Americas, organised by Panam Sports.
